Farmers in Mesoamerica face a variety of problems, including a lack of available land and bad soil quality. Slash-and-burn techniques and leaving fields fallow for a period of time in a milpa cycle are the two primary ways to tackle poor soil quality, or a lack of nutrients in the soil.
